You are right, LwIP doesn't interface to RMII (direct).
I does however in most cases, through driver.
RMII is still a "too many wires" port, and therefore folks often
talk about options to reduce this set.
I'm happy that my 2cents resulted in a friutful discission
(and even we now know the way to use SPI for that).
On my side, I happened to write a NC-SI LwIP driver (NXP LPC1768 platform)
which requires no MDIO for PHY configuration, and therefore is 2 wires
less wide than RMII is.
While not many chips support NC-SI, maybe this my $1 addition will
be helpful to somebody (attached is a NC-SI driver for LwIP source).
Sorry, I'm not that fluent with LwIP internals to store the code to the sorces,
therefore I'm attaching it here. Feel free to do whatever you like with it,
or to ask questions.

>> LwIP or any other TCP stack need to read/or data to/from the MAC interface.
>> This is the hardware driver that connects
>> the LwIP with the hardware.
>
> These words might imply lwIP connects to RMII, but it doesn't. The
> interface between lwIP and the MAC can be a parallel bus (e.g. MAC
> included in the micro or external MAC connected to a memory-mapped bus),
> or a serial interface (e.g. SPI) or anything else.
> The MAC then converts to (R/G/whatever)-MII, followed by the PHY
> converting to the media.
>
> I wrote this only to make it clear that lwIP does not in any way
> interface MII.

/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- */
// ncsi_reset() :: DTMF 6.2.13.1 - non-hardware arbitration startup sequence.
// * Discover NC-SI-attached packages and package channels;
// * Read the NC-SI properties;
// * Assign MAC address(es).
// Commands used:
// 1. Using the Select Package discover NCSI packages (cmd = 0x01)
// 2. Using the Clear Initial State discover channels (cmd = 0x00)
// 3. (option) Get ID and statistics (cmd = 0x15..0x1A)
// 4. Set MAC (cmd = 0x0E)
// 5. Set filter(s) (cmd = 0x10)
// 6. Channel (Network pass-through Tx/Rx) Enable (cmd = 0x03, 0x06)
void
ncsi_reset()
{
UINT8 i, j, ID;
for( i = 0; i <= NCSI_MAX_PACKAGE_ID; i++){
ID = i << 5 | NCSI_CHANNEL_ID_BROADCAST;
ncsi_control(NCSI_SELECT_PACKAGE, &ID);
ncsi_control(NCSI_DESELECT_PACKAGE, &ID);
}
for ( i = 0, j = 0; i <= NCSI_MAX_PACKAGE_ID; i++ ){
if(0xFF != NCSI_Package[i]) j++;
}
if( 0 != j ){
DPUTHEX( DBG_OTHER_MEDIA, "ncsi_reset : ", j, " packages found.\n" );
eth_link_on = 1;
} else {
DPRINTF( DBG_OTHER_MEDIA, "ncsi_reset : no packages.\n" );
eth_link_on = 0;
return;
}
// we will use/support single package at this time!
ID = (NCSI_Package[0] << 5) | NCSI_CHANNEL_ID_BROADCAST;
ncsi_control(NCSI_SELECT_PACKAGE, &ID);
ncsi_get_ncsi_statistics(); // reset counters
// Note: ch=NCSI_MAX_CHANNEL_ID is a broadcast ID, we do not include it.
for ( i = 0, ID = NCSI_Package[0]<<5; i < NCSI_MAX_CHANNEL_ID; i++ ){
ncsi_control(NCSI_CLEAR_INITIAL_STATE, &ID);
ID += 1; // next channel
}
for ( i = 0, j = 0; i < NCSI_MAX_CHANNEL_ID; i++ ){
if(0xFF != NCSI_Channel[i]) j++;
}
DPUTHEX( DBG_OTHER_MEDIA, "ncsi_reset : ", j, " channels found.\n" );
// initialize first channel available, this is a default
ncsi_control(NCSI_SET_MAC_ADDRESS, &IPMInetIF.hwaddr[0]);
ncsi_control(NCSI_ENABLE_BROADCAST_FILTER, NULL);
ID = (NCSI_Package[0]<<5) | ncsi_channel_selected;
ncsi_control(NCSI_ENABLE_CHANNEL, &ID);
ncsi_control(NCSI_ENABLE_CHANNEL_TX, &ID);
} // ncsi_reset
